Finance Review Summary – Orvanne Components Ltd.

The review covered our search for a second-source supplier for the Kestrel valve assembly. Three candidates were assessed on capacity, pricing, and lead time; two remain under consideration. Qualification costs are within the approved envelope. A recommendation will follow next quarter. The board should also note the confidential item below.

internal memo for faweg-tafog: Only 7 of the 100 pilot accounts renewed Quenael, so a churn review is set for April 15.

**Mgmt Meeting Minutes — Retiring the Brightline Range**

Quick recap for sales leads at Fenholt Supplies: we agreed to retire the Brightline fixture range by year-end. Remaining stock moves to clearance pricing next month, and accounts on standing orders get migrated to the Lumetta range. Trade-in incentives were approved in principle. The confidential note on next steps sits just below.

board note of bajof-bajeg: The pricing group signed off on a budget of $13.4 million for Project Sildor. The renewal with Lamixek Holdings closes at $48.9 million a year, 49 percent above the last contract.

Account recovery — Renderhawk transcoding farm. Release manager: if the farm's service account is locked mid-release, halt all pending encode batches first, then initiate recovery through the Ashgrove control plane. Verify the audit trail shows no unauthorized job submissions before restoring access. Once the checks pass, unseal the escrowed credentials bundle by entering the recovery passphrase provided below.

vault phrase of fahog-yajog = frawyn-jordor-casael-gormir-olieth-julmir

Subject: On-call handover — Sketchloom undo/redo

Hi Priya,

Handing over the Sketchloom diagram editor shift. The undo/redo stack has been flaky since the 4.2 rollout: redo occasionally replays connector moves twice when collaborative mode is on. I've pinned the history service to single-writer as a stopgap and filed a ticket with repro steps. Watch the `history-drift` alert; it fires before users notice. For anything deeper in the CRDT layer, reach the Canvas Core team directly.

escalation mailbox, hadug-bajog: sormir@norvalabs.internal